Glastonbury, a small town in the English countryside, is renowned as the mystical Isle of Avalon - a place of myth and legend, and the spiritual heart of the country. It was a centre of druidic learning, a place of goddess worship and healing, the site of the first Christian church in Britain, and the reputed location of King Arthur's Camelot. Today it remains sacred to people of all religions and cultures, yet it hides many of its secrets within the mysterious mists of Avalon.
